When thermoplastics are moulded, typically pelletised Uncooked material is fed via a hopper into a heated barrel that has a reciprocating screw. On entrance on the barrel, the temperature increases as well as the Van der Waals forces that resist relative flow of particular person chains are weakened on account of improved space among molecules at larger thermal Electricity states. This method lessens its viscosity, which permits the polymer to stream While using the driving drive of your injection unit. The screw delivers the Uncooked substance forward, mixes and homogenises the thermal and viscous distributions in the polymer, and minimizes the needed heating time by mechanically shearing the fabric and incorporating a big quantity of frictional heating for the polymer. The fabric feeds forward through a Verify valve and collects within the front of the screw right into a volume often known as a shot. A shot is the volume of fabric which is used to fill the mould cavity, compensate for shrinkage, and provide a cushion (about ten% of the entire shot volume, which remains while in the barrel and prevents the screw from bottoming out) to transfer stress from the screw for the mould cavity. When adequate material has collected, the material is compelled at substantial force and velocity in the portion forming cavity.
